Course Content

• Introduction to Mathematical Text Analysis: Corpus Linguistics & Preprocessing
• Statistical Methods for Text Analysis: Frequency Distributions & Collocations
• Vector Space Models & Dimensionality Reduction: Latent Semantic Analysis (LSA)
• Topic Modeling Techniques: Latent Dirichlet Allocation (LDA) & Non-negative Matrix Factorization (NMF)
• Sentiment Analysis & Opinion Mining: Lexicon-based & Machine Learning Approaches
• Network Analysis of Text: Social Network Analysis & Text Network Visualization
• Advanced Machine Learning for Text Analysis: Deep Learning & Recurrent Neural Networks (RNNs)
• Evaluation Metrics for Text Analysis: Precision, Recall, F1-Score & ROC Curves
• Case Studies in Mathematical Text Analysis: Applications & Real-world Examples
• Mathematical Text Analysis Tools & Software: R, Python & Specialized Packages
